1 Forest context1. Forest context

• Forest cover: 40 million ha (51% of the country ( ysurface)

M i l Mi b f t• Mainly Miombo forests (dryforests)

• Annual deforestation rate: 0.58% (1990‐2005)( )

3. National REDD+ Strategic objectives ( d)(proposed)

1. Establishment of a coordination platform for a permanent stab s e t o a coo d at o p at o o a pe a e tdialog across sectors on drivers and solutions for DD and carbon sequestration

2. Reduce the conversion of forests to non‐forest in the mid‐l tlong term

3 Avoid conversion of dense forests into open forests3. Avoid conversion of dense forests into open forests

4. Promote forest and tree plantation, including agroforestry systems, in non‐forest areas and degraded forests 19

4 O t iti4. Opportunities

• Existing policy framework is supportive for REDD+ ‐ “just” needs implementation

• Experience with Benefit‐Sharing (20% revenue distribution mechanism +  Voluntary Carbon 

d / b )trade/carbon PES projects)• South‐South Cooperation with FAS‐Brazil• Some financial support (Norway and Japan, potentially FCPF)p y )

Financial mechanisms and benefit sharingFinancial mechanisms and benefit sharing

• ChallengesChallenges– Carbon rights vs land/forest rights– State owned land and forestsState owned land and forests– DUAT can be revoked– Poor implementation of policies/lawsp p /– No clear land use plans and territorial zoning– Money reaching the ground– Information on the cost of REDD+ (Opportunity Cost, Transaction Cost, etc.) 

– Capacity for fund raising for REDD+31
